To run chkdsk using the Windows 11 GUI, open Windows File Explorer, navigate to the hard drive volume you … highbridge tradingWebApr 9, 2024 · Open Command Prompt as an administrator. Type "chkdsk C: /r /x" (without quotes) and press Enter. You should receive a message asking if you want to schedule the disk check for the next time you restart your computer. Type "Y" (without quotes) and press Enter. Restart your computer and let chkdsk run during the bootup process. highbridge to wells busWebOct 17, 2024 · Click your Start Button, then just type cmd.
